Different tools and strategies can be used during a mental health assessment. Below are some commonly utilized methods:

Structured Interviews: These interviews utilize standardized questions, providing constant data collection. Examples consist of the Structured Clinical Interview for DSM (SCID).

Self-Report Questionnaires: Patients complete standardized questionnaires examining mindsets, such as the Beck Depression Inventory (BDI) or the Generalized Anxiety Disorder 7-item scale (GAD-7).

Behavioral Assessments: These concentrate on observable behaviors and might involve ranking scales or direct observation.

Neuropsychological Testing: In cases where cognitive disability is thought, more comprehensive assessments may be performed to examine memory, attention, and other cognitive abilities.

Security Information: Gathering information from household members or loved ones can supply additional contextual information about the person's behavior and history.

Q: How long does a mental health assessment take?A: The period differs depending upon the complexity of the case and the methods utilized. Assessments can range from one hour to numerous sessions throughout several visits.
